Sunday Night Football: Texans Get Seven Sacks, Two Picks in a 19-13 Win Over Bears

Houston improves to 1-2-1 with the win, while Chicago falls to 2-2.

Defense leads the way for Texans

The Houston Texans defense was the star of the show on Sunday night, as they sacked Bears quarterback Justin Fields seven times and intercepted him twice. The Texans also forced two fumbles, one of which they recovered. The Texans' pass rush was particularly impressive, as they were able to generate pressure on Fields all night long. Defensive end Jonathan Greenard led the way with three sacks, while defensive tackle Maliek Collins added two. The Texans' secondary also played well, as they were able to limit the Bears' passing attack to just 148 yards. Cornerback Derek Stingley Jr. had a particularly impressive game, as he intercepted Fields twice.

Offense struggles for both teams

The offenses for both teams struggled on Sunday night, as neither team was able to score more than 19 points. The Texans were able to move the ball well at times, but they were unable to finish drives. The Bears' offense was even worse, as they were only able to gain 148 yards of total offense. Fields was sacked seven times and intercepted twice, and he was also unable to complete more than 50% of his passes.

Texans win despite offensive struggles

Despite their offensive struggles, the Texans were able to win the game thanks to their defense. The Texans' defense was able to force the Bears into several turnovers, and they were also able to generate a lot of pressure on Fields. The Texans' win is their first of the season, and it moves them to 1-2-1 on the year. The Bears fall to 2-2 with the loss.
